{Reference Type}: Journal Article {Title}: Advances in Sleep-Disordered Breathing in Children. {Author}: Gileles-Hillel A;Bhattacharjee R;Gorelik M;Narang I; {Journal}: Clin Chest Med {Volume}: 45 {Issue}: 3 {Year}: 2024 Sep {Factor}: 4.967 {DOI}: 10.1016/j.ccm.2024.03.004 {Abstract}: Pediatric sleep-disordered breathing disorders are a group of common conditions, from habitual snoring to ob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) syndrome, affecting a significant proportion of children. The present article summarizes the current knowledge on diagnosis and treatment of pediatric OSA focusing on therapeutic and surgical advancements in the field in recent years. Advancements in OSA such as biomarkers, improving continuous pressure therapy adherence, novel pharmacotherapies, and advanced surgeries are discussed.
